Distribution, mechanisms and evolutionary significance of clonality and polyploidy in weevils
1 Genetical mtDNA relationships of 41 taxa of weevils were examined using cladistics. Ingroup taxa belong to Otiorhynchus scaber and O. nodosus and outgroup comparison was made with O. singularis.
